irisheyes66 08-28-2004, 06:23 PM It definitely varies from one facility to another.
My guy is in the Kansas DOC...when he was at El Dorado, a Max prison, I could send just about anything and the mail would go through. Several times I kissed the letter, envelope, etc.
Since he was transferred to Larned, though, I tried sending a "kiss", and the letter was promptly returned to me, with the word "CONTRABAND" in huge black letters. There was a tiny list of reasons, and "No lipstick/perfume allowed" was checked off.
Larned is a mental health facility, so that may be part of the problem. They are a lot stricter on what can be sent in. Oddly enough, I spray perfume on every letter, and none have ever been sent back until I put the "kiss" on the envelope that time.
